fix(explore): do not create extra layer for empty entries (#15367)

Fixes #15329

# Description

Stops entering empty list/record with the following message:

@ -457,7 +457,9 @@ impl CursorMoveHandler for RecordView {
fn create_layer(value: Value) -> Result<RecordLayer> {
let (columns, values) = collect_input(value)?;
if columns.is_empty() {
return Err(anyhow::anyhow!("Nothing to explore in empty collections!"));
}
Ok(RecordLayer::new(columns, values))
}
